Uterine leiomyosarcoma well-controlled with eribulin mesylate
Etsuko Fujimoto1, Kazuhiro Takehara1, Tamaki Tanaka1
11Department of Gynecologic Oncology, National Hospital Organization Shikoku Cancer Center, Ko-160 Minamiumemoto, Matsuyama, 791-0280 Japan.
Eribulin, a marine-derived drug, showed effectiveness in treating a patient with advanced uterine leiomyosarcoma. Despite initial tumor reduction, the cancer eventually progressed, but eribulin offered a manageable treatment option with few side effects.

Background:
- Uterine leiomyosarcoma is a rare, aggressive gynecological cancer with limited treatment options and poor prognosis.
- Eribulin, a synthetic analogue of halichondrin B from a marine sponge, has shown promise in treating certain advanced solid tumors.
Observation:
- A 57-year-old woman with advanced uterine leiomyosarcoma (Stage IIB) underwent surgery and multiple lines of chemotherapy, including gemcitabine and docetaxel, with disease progression.
- Eribulin was administered as a fourth-line treatment, resulting in a 32% tumor mass reduction after four cycles.
- While eribulin demonstrated efficacy, tumor growth eventually resumed after eight cycles. The primary adverse event was mild neutropenia.
Findings:
- Eribulin demonstrated a partial response in a patient with recurrent, treatment-resistant uterine leiomyosarcoma.
- The drug was well-tolerated, with minimal adverse events and a good quality of life for the patient.
- This case highlights eribulin's potential as a salvage therapy for advanced gynecological sarcomas.
Implications:
- Eribulin may offer a viable treatment option for patients with advanced or recurrent uterine leiomyosarcoma, particularly when other therapies have failed.
- The favorable safety profile and ease of administration of eribulin support its consideration in treatment-naive and refractory settings.
- Further research is warranted to establish optimal dosing, treatment duration, and combination strategies for eribulin in gynecological sarcoma management.
